Shelby Township, MI: big-suburb convenience with parks, trails, cider mill traditions, and deep automotive history
HIGHLIGHTS
Shelby Township (often called Shelby Twp) is a large community in Macomb County that offers a classic βroom to breatheβ suburban lifestyle with standout outdoor recreation and a few well-known local landmarks. Shelby Township is about 35 square miles, so it has a mix of neighborhood pockets, parks, and commercial corridors that make day-to-day life convenient while still feeling spacious.
Within Shelby Township, locals sometimes reference smaller community areas such as Preston Corners, Shelby, Shelby Village, and Yates. These names are often used as shorthand to describe where someone lives inside a township with a large footprint.

What Shelby Township is known for
1) Stony Creek Metropark (a major regional outdoor destination).
One of Shelby Townshipβs biggest lifestyle draws is Stony Creek Metropark, a go-to spot for trails, nature time, and outdoor recreation. Many residents build weekend routines around walking, biking, picnicking, and spending time near the water.
2) Yates Cider Mill + Yates Park (fall traditions and local favorites).
Shelby Township is home to Yates Cider Mill and Yates Park, a classic Southeast Michigan destination for cider, donuts, and fall weekends. For many families, it becomes a yearly tradition.
3) Packard Proving Grounds (a unique piece of Michigan history).
The Packard Proving Grounds is one of the areaβs most distinctive historic sites and a cool reminder of Michiganβs automotive legacy.
4) Trail access, including the Macomb Orchard Trail.
Shelby Township is a great fit for people who love walking, running, and biking thanks to trail options like the Macomb Orchard Trail, which connects into broader regional trail networks.

Frequently Asked Questions About Living in Shelby Township, MI
Is Shelby Township a good place to live?
It can be a great fit if you want a spacious suburban community with strong parks and trail access and plenty of family-friendly neighborhoods.
What is Shelby Township known for?
Stony Creek Metropark, Yates Cider Mill and Yates Park, the Packard Proving Grounds, and recreation opportunities like the Macomb Orchard Trail.
Is Shelby Township a city?
Shelby Township is a township (not a city), and it includes multiple community areas within its borders.
What are the community areas inside Shelby Township?
Locals often reference Preston Corners, Shelby, Shelby Village, and Yates when describing where they live inside the township.
What kind of lifestyle does Shelby Township offer?
A comfortable, family-friendly suburban lifestyle with easy access to parks, trails, and classic Michigan fall traditions.
